基于GIS技术的公路养护管理信息化系统的设计与应用

2023-10-24 11:06宋博
运输经理世界 2023年20期
关键词:巡查公路信息化

宋博

(甘肃畅陇公路养护技术研究院有限公司,甘肃兰州 730010)

0 引言

截至2022 年4 月,我国公路里程已经达到528 万公里,实施预防性养护的公路135.6 万公里、修复养护165.2 万公里,实施安全生命防护的公路工程116 万公里,改造危桥5.8 万座。可见,在我国公路交通的发展中,公路养护与管理工作是重中之重。在信息技术飞速发展的时代,相关部门应重视在公路养护管理中应用信息技术,采集并分析公路养护数据,以提升养护管理水平。

1 公路养护管理信息化系统建设的重要性

1.1 节约运维成本

公路交通的里程较长,且广泛分布于全国各个地区,在对公路进行养护管理时,涉及很多学科技术,需要养护管理人员掌握多种学科的专业技术,尤其是信息技术。由于依靠人力对公路进行巡检的效率较低,且可能增加运维成本,而建设基于GIS 技术的公路养护管理信息化系统,可以通过先进的信息技术对公路交通网络进行实时监测,及时发现公路存在的问题,并采取合理的措施及时解决,能有效节约运维成本[1]。

1.2 保障交通安全

为确保公路交通安全,促进公路交通健康发展,公路养护管理相关部门应重视公路养护管理信息化系统建设。

公路交通结构相对复杂,包括隧道、桥梁等设施,环境也十分多样,不仅包括平原,还包括高山、峡谷等区域。因此,进行公路养护时,不仅要对公路路面、桥梁、隧道结构等进行维护,还要合理布置、维护交通标志、照明设施及通信设备等,以有效降低公路交通事故发生率[2]。

建设公路养护管理信息化系统,能实时对道路状况和周围环境进行全方位监测,有助于加强对交通安全事故的预防,更有效地保障交通安全。

2 基于GIS 技术的公路养护管理信息化系统设计方法

2.1 信息化系统分析

建设公路养护管理信息化系统时需要利用地图数据及公路养护数据,其中地图数据应包括各级区域的划分标记,各级公路的划分标记,桥梁、隧道及高速路口标记,各级公路路线,河流、铁路、土路标记,城市、村屯标记等。相关部门应通过测绘技术获取地图数据,然后将其导入空间数据库,设计标识符号[3]。

公路养护数据包括由专业设备检测采集到的数据、人工日常记录的数据等。前者主要包括道路的路线、形状、平整度、路面弯沉情况以及车辙情况等,后者主要包括路基、路面、桥梁和隧道的损坏、病害情况,对应的施工技术等。进行数据采集时,地图数据基本可以自动录入,公路养护数据则需人工录入。

为提升公路养护计划和规划的科学性,保证各项工作有条不紊地进行,进行公路养护管理信息化系统建设时,工作人员首先要解决的是数据采集效率低、数据不准确等问题。

2.2 构建系统的总体框架

进行公路养护管理信息化系统建设时,可应用浏览器或者服务器进行总体框架的架构,总体框架包括三层:底层数据层、中间服务层以及上层应用层。

在具体设计中,数据层可利用非关系型数据库MongoDB 和空间型数据库PostgreSQL 存储地图数据、文件数据以及业务数据[4]。服务层的设计目的主要是为公路养护管理信息化系统提供数据交互、分析和处理的平台,同时提供地图服务。在服务器上进行服务层设计时,可以根据实际需求对数据进行处理,并按照一定的算法进行数据计算,经过处理的数据需要传输到应用层。

设计公路养护管理信息化系统的服务端业务后台时,可利用微服务技术进行架构,这样有利于该系统功能在服务中的展现,从而对解决方案进行解耦,提高系统运行效率。在微服务架构中,采取模块化设计方式,将该系统划分为养护巡查、养护资金、养护考评模块,再利用SpringBoot 对相关数据进行整合和处理,并将数据变为JSON 格式实现交互。

服务层通过WebGIS 技术可以为公路养护管理信息化系统提供地图服务,在实际的应用中主要利用GeoGerver 进行地图的发布,用户可以通过GeoGerver对GIS 数据进行查看与编辑,并根据一定的标准创建地图,实现数据分享。进行公路养护管理信息化系统设计时,可以采取Web 地图切片技术实现地图的发布,然后利用矢量瓦片技术对数据进行切片处理并在服务器中进行储存。公路养护管理信息化系统的应用层位于终端设备上,可以实现和用户的交互,促进数据信息的应用。

应用层可以对数据信息进行展示和操作,利用图表和矢量瓦片地图等手段表达出公路养护数据。在构建公路养护管理信息化系统时,工作人员可以利用JavaScript 框架,通过Vue-router 实现路由跳转,建设基础组件库和图表组件库,在后台实现数据交互。Web 浏览器在开展地图服务时,通过渲染技术(Web-GL),借助于系统显卡可以完成2D 地图和3D 地图的展示[5]。该系统在应用渲染技术进行矢量瓦片地图的渲染时,选择MapboxGL 库,以确保渲染的高性能,并对矢量数据进行有效解析,生成各种形态的场景地图。

2.3 设计系统的各个功能

进行公路养护管理信息化系统设计时,根据公路养护的实际需求,可设计巡查管理、资金管理和考评管理三个模块。

在公路养护管理工作中,巡查管理的主要内容有:公路路段的日常养护、保洁、排水、路基保养、维修以及病害处理等,同时需要进行桥梁、隧道、沿线设施的检查、保养和维修,在特殊天气还需要对路面进行处理,如在冬天进行冰雪清理等[6]。

设计公路养护信息化管理系统时,需整合公路巡查的相关工作,通过Web 端和移动端APP 的交互,建立巡查管理系统,由巡查工作人员在巡查过程中于APP 上进行信息更新,然后由管理人员对信息进行审批,审批结束之后系统通知工作人员对公路问题进行处理。问题处理过程中,巡查管理系统需要针对更新的信息,及时给出人工和材料等信息,问题处理好之后进行处置信息上报。公路管理人员应根据工作人员上报的信息对公路处理情况进行验收。

利用GIS 技术,Web 地图可以绘制出巡查工作人员的路线,实现巡查工作的可视化管理。该系统在应用过程中可以为管理人员提供巡查工作进展和养护服务情况,实现养护信息和养护工作的一体化管理[7]。

在不同等级公路的养护过程中,需要根据公路等级和养护手段的不同,采取定额管理和项目管理办法,对公路养护资金进行有效管理。在系统设计中,工作人员应根据定额管理办法,设计计量支付模块,对养护过程中使用的材料、人力、设备等数据进行分析和统计,建立数据模型,促进养护资金的合理分配,控制公路养护的成本。

进行公路养护管理工作时,可以利用信息化管理系统,建立考评管理模块,对公路养护工作进行考评。在具体工作中,工作人员应以数据采集车采集的数据为基础建立考评管理模块,根据对公路的养护情况对养护工作进行打分,并使用相机拍照记录,再利用GPS 定位系统对道路坐标进行标记。考评管理模块针对采集车采集的相关信息进行分析,可以自动生成公路网络的质量评价内容,管理人员可以通过质量评价了解公路养护的实际状况,同时对工作人员进行绩效考评,提高工作的标准化和专业化。

2.4 系统开发的关键技术

设计公路养护管理信息化系统在时需要开发出多个功能模块,还要与路政系统、建设系统以及大数据平台等进行连接,并实现数据的交互,微服务架构可以实现服务解耦,以实现不同服务的独立部署,使其具有可拓展性,能够对服务进行延展。

单体架构的模式无法适应当前业务拓展和模块功能交互的需求,因此工作人员进行系统设计时,需要开发微服务技术,建立弹性接口,以应对多种服务功能的实现。

在系统设计过程中,工作人员可开发矢量瓦片地图技术,可以通过对金字塔模型的应用,对多分辨率的数据进行储存,保留属性数据,降低网络传输数量,实现地图响应速度的提升[8]。矢量瓦片地图技术在应用时主要是通过数据分割技术,将数据分割成较小的单元,再进行绘制数据的传输,而绘制数据在前端已经被定义,可以实现地图样式的配置和图层分级。

3 公路养护管理信息化系统应用

3.1 养护巡查APP

公路养护人员在日常巡查过程中,使用养护巡查APP 可以实现日常数据的更新和养护数据的上报,从而实现养护人员和管理人员之间的沟通,完善养护工作计划,使公路养护工作更加科学、规范。

养护巡查APP 的主要功能有公路养护工作的查询、上报和处置,巡查工作人员在使用养护巡查APP的时候可以进行巡查和工作的创建、巡查地点的确定以及巡查路线的记录[9]。养护巡查APP 还可以根据公路的路况检测指数,结合巡查数据情况,确定养护类型及养护设计方案,并对现场的情况进行拍照上传,确定工程量信息,然后将其传输到系统中。管理人员可以对养护工作进行查询,对巡查工作人员的工作进行验收。养护巡查APP 工作流程如图1 所示。

图1 养护巡查APP 工作流程图

3.2 信息采集车

应用GIS 技术对公路养护管理信息化系统进行设计,需要获取全面、准确的数据信息,因此可以进行信息采集车的开发和应用,通过车载采集软件对公路的养护数据进行采集。

在具体工作中,信息采集车可以通过车载GPS 系统、编码器和全景相机对公路养护数据进行采集。首先,需要导入行政区划地图和任务表;其次,需要利用GPS 系统获取巡查轨迹和公路定位;最后,根据公路评价标准,针对公路养护的实际情况,采集相应的数据信息。采集工作结束以后,系统会根据评价标准自动生成扣分表,然后通过Web 端的导入模块上传到服务器进行管理。

3.3 养护管理信息系统

养护管理信息系统是重要的功能系统,该系统可以对巡查工作进行分析和统计,根据地图数据,对巡查轨迹进行可视化管理,并对养护管理工作进行分类,通过各项数据的应用提高公路养护管理效率[10]。

在养护管理信息系统中,管理人员可以通过接入地图服务对公路网络进行展示,并通过GIS 技术对巡查工作进行分析。资金管理模块可导入地方养护定额,以实现对材料单价的管理,分析资金的使用情况,为地方养护定额的修订提供可靠依据。考评管理模块可以实现对采集数据的科学管理和分析,确定扣分情况,统计扣分信息。

4 结语

总之,利用浏览器或者服务器构建系统的总体框架,合理设计数据层、服务层和应用层,并开发系统的巡查管理、资金管理以及考评管理体系等,建设基于GIS 技术的公路养护管理信息化系统,可为公路的养护和管理工作提供可靠的信息化服务。

猜你喜欢
巡查公路信息化
我国建成第三条穿越塔克拉玛干沙漠公路
“十四五”浙江将再投8000亿元修公路新增公路5000km
月“睹”教育信息化
幼儿教育信息化策略初探
公路断想
高速公路机电设备巡查模型探讨
昼夜巡查不间断
公路造价控制中的预结算审核
自治区安委会巡查组分赴各市开展巡查工作
安徽中小型水库巡查值守实现GPS定位